58914a69c3 index: ordered _id index (roadmap item 2)
Give every Collection an implicit _id_ index (a normal Index with keys
[_id: 1]) so _id equality, $in, ranges and sorts stop depending on the
docs-map hash or a full scan. Kept out of the secondary indexes list, so
listIndexes/dropIndexes/createIndex and the log format are unchanged (no
index_create record, no double listing) and e2e3.js passes unmodified.

Maintained in upsert through the same reserve-then-insert protocol as
the secondaries, removed in evict_doc, and rebuilt after replay by
build_all_indexes alongside them (never maintained mid-replay, so a
failed add can't leave the index under-approximating). index.plan now
takes it as a separate argument. Its keys are canonical
(bson.encode_key gives int32 1, int64 1 and double 1.0 identical bytes),
so the serialization-guarded docs-map fast path (plan_id,
value_fast_path_safe and friends) is deleted.

Measured (tests/e2e/results/phase3.txt): sort({_id:-1}).limit(20) 6.2 ->
2.4 ms (2.3x slower than MongoDB -> parity); integer/string _id point
lookups, $in and ranges verified against the tree. Unit suite in all
three optimize modes, the crash pair, e2e3/e2e4/e2e6.

61fe952125 index: B+tree over the encoded keys (roadmap item 1)
Replace Index.entries (one sorted array) with a B+tree so writes into an
already-built index stop being quadratic. Nodes are fixed 4 KiB slotted
pages in a flat u32-addressed ArrayListUnmanaged(Node); records longer
than a quarter page spill to an append-only overflow slab (BSON strings
reach 16 MB). Leaves are doubly linked for ordered iteration; the flat
node array stays one contiguous byte range for a later checkpoint.

Insertion descends by separator and splits leaves/internals upward,
promoting keys via a stable copy (a nested split can otherwise clobber
the promoted-key scratch). Deletion does not rebalance: emptied leaves
are unlinked and dropped from their parent, internal nodes may carry one
child, and dead pages are abandoned in place (node memory peaks at the
tree's peak size, exactly what the old array's capacity did). Lookups
are lower-bound seeks plus leaf-chain band scans, so equal keys may
span leaves freely. Bulk build (append_doc_entries + finish_bulk) sorts
a staging array and packs leaves bottom-up. reserve_for now takes the
built entries and reserves exact overflow bytes plus a worst-case node
count, keeping insert_entries infallible after the log append.

db.zig: TTL sweep now seeks the minimum-datetime encoded key and walks
the contiguous datetime band, stopping at the cutoff or type change.

Measured (tests/e2e/results/phase2.txt): updateMany 17.3 -> 1.8 ms
(2.8x slower than MongoDB -> 3.7x faster), createIndex 62 -> 51 ms.

Verified: unit suite ReleaseFast/ReleaseSafe/Debug (incl. the existing
lookup_range and remove_doc differentials, plus a new incremental
insert/remove differential against a brute-force model), the crash pair,
e2e3/e2e4/e2e6, and dev stress tests for depth-2 splits, full drains,
and spilled records through internal levels.

71112b0ff7 ROADMAP: write up the remaining performance work
Five items in dependency order, each sized to land on its own. The design
decisions already settled are recorded so they are not re-derived, and so
are the ordering constraints, which are the part that actually matters --
notably that the _id index must follow the tree, because it updates on
every insert and against a sorted array that is only affordable while ids
happen to append at the end.

Also carries the ground rules the earlier work established: A/B on one
harness rather than trusting a model, mutation-check tests that guard an
invariant, and the two absolutes (an index may only over-approximate; the
database must always open).

Each item names the traps found while investigating it -- deletion being
where B+trees go wrong, listIndexes possibly noticing a real _id_ index,
hashing compressed rather than uncompressed bytes, the fabricated
Document values that break when Document changes meaning, and the
durability guarantee that quietly weakens under group commit.
